- Daniel Barenboim has announced he has Parkinson's disease, stating, 'I would like to share today that I have Parkinson's disease.'
- Barenboim, 82, was the head of the Berlin State Opera until 2023 and is known for founding the West-Eastern Divan Orchestra with Edward Said.
- He expressed his commitment to continue conducting the West-Eastern Divan Orchestra 'whenever my health allows me to.'
- Barenboim has received numerous accolades, including an honorary knighthood and the Royal Philharmonic Society Gold Medal.
